Mississippi SB2866 authorizes an income tax credit for contributions to qualifying charitable organizations.
Mississippi SB2866 allows taxpayers to claim an income tax credit for voluntary cash contributions to qualifying charitable organizations. The credit is limited to 50% of the taxpayer's total tax liability for the year. Unused credits can be carried forward for five consecutive years. Qualifying organizations must be exempt from federal income tax under Section 501(c)(3) of the Internal Revenue Code, spend at least 50% of their budget on services to qualified individuals in Mississippi, and provide services to at least 15 qualified individuals annually.
